Step 1: Water Extraction
Our technician will use a powerful truck-mounted extractor to remove the standing water from your property. This equipment can extract up to 10 gallons of water per minute, making it an essential tool in the under sink water extraction process.
Step 2: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is extracted, our technician will use dehumidifiers and fans to dry out your property. This step is crucial in preventing mold and mildew growth, which can lead to further damage and health issues.
Step 3: Disinfecting and Cleaning
After the drying process is complete, our technician will disinfect and clean your property to remove any remaining moisture and bacteria. This step ensures your home is safe and healthy to occupy.
Step 4: Monitoring and Follow-up
Our team will monitor your property to ensure it’s completely dry and free from moisture. We’ll also follow up with you to ensure you’re satisfied with the work and that your home is back to normal.

Under Sink Water Extraction Cost in Edgefield, SC
The cost of under sink water extraction in Edgefield, SC,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ate and work closely with your insurance company to ensure maximum coverage.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and duration of service |
| Disinfecting and Cleaning |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and duration of service |
| Monitoring and Follow-up |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and duration of service |
| Emergency Service Fee | $200 – $1,000 | Time of day, day of the week, and location |

Common Questions About Under Sink Water Extraction
What causes under sink water damage?
Under sink water damage is often caused by leaks, burst pipes, or overflowing appliances. It’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.
How long does under sink water extraction take?
The length of time it takes to extract water and dry out your property dep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will provide a customized plan and timeline to ensure the job is done efficiently and effectively.
Is under sink water extraction covered by insurance?
Yes, under sink water extraction is often covered by insurance. Our team will work closely with your insurance company to ensure maximum coverage and a smooth claims process.
How can I prevent under sink water damage?
Preventing under sink water damage needs regular maintenance and inspections. Check your appliances and pipes regularly for signs of wear and tear, and address any issues quickly to prevent further damage.
